STOKESAY CASTLE
10 miles from Whitton Parish
Stokesay Castle is quite simply the finest and best preserved fortified medieval manor house in England.
EDVIN LOACH OLD CHURCH
11 miles from Whitton Parish
The ruins of an 11th century and later church built within the earthworks of a Norman motte and bailey castle, with a Victorian church nearby. The site of hundreds of years of worship.
WIGMORE CASTLE
11 miles from Whitton Parish
One of the most important castles in the history of the Welsh Marches and major centre of power for over 500 years, hosting royalty on several occasions. Deliberately demolished during the Civil War.
WITLEY COURT AND GARDENS
13 miles from Whitton Parish
A hundred years ago, Witley Court was one of England's great country houses, hosting many extravagant parties. Today it is a spectacular ruin, the result of a disastrous fire in 1937.
LANGLEY CHAPEL
17 miles from Whitton Parish
A small chapel tranquilly set all alone in charming countryside. Its atmospheric interior contains a perfect set of 17th-century timber furnishings, including a musicians' pew.
WENLOCK PRIORY
17 miles from Whitton Parish
Tranquil ruins in lovely setting. Re-founded by the Normans as a priory. Unusual washing fountain with 12th century carvings, extravagantly decorated chapter house, topiary-filled cloister garden.
